Transformer Description:
A dry-type water-cooled transformer is a type of dry-type transformer that uses water as the cooling medium. It is based on dry-type transformers, combining water and dry-type transformers to form a new type of transformer.
Transformer Features:
In dry-type water-cooled transformers, cooling water circulates through pipelines for heat dissipation. Its core component is a high-temperature nano insulator, which has high insulation strength and stability, ensuring the safe and stable operation of the transformer. During the operation of the transformer, the heat generated inside the transformer is transferred to the high-temperature nano insulator and then transferred to the transformer casing through the thermal conductivity pipeline of the high-temperature insulator. Then, the accumulated heat of the transformer is discharged through the heat exchanger and water circulation system, achieving the cooling of the transformer. This cooling method is more efficient than traditional natural air cooling and forced air cooling methods, improving the cooling capacity and efficiency of transformers and making them more energy-efficient.

Transformer Chracteristics
Transformer Core
1. The core is made of high quality grain-oriented cold-rollled silicon steel of high magnetic conductivity, by using 45°five-step overlapping method to reduce the no-load loss and no-load current.
2. Simulation analysis method is applied for the core design, thus to precisely and effectively calculate the vibration frequency and scale.
3. Flexible connections are adopted between the core and coils, core and clamps. With these measures, transformer's noise level has been improved by 10-15dB over the conventional products.
Transformer Windings
LV windings
1. For LV windings above 400 kVA capacity, superior foil conductors are adopted for winding manufacturing, thus to obtain better amper-turn balance and less transverse magnetic flux leakage, and finally to greatly improves transformer's anti-short circuit capability.
2. By reasonably designing the oil passage within the winding, winding's heat dispersion effect is greatly increased. Thus the reasonable design has decreased temperature rise and improved products' overload capability.
HV windings
1. HV windings are manufactured with superior wire conductors, insulated reinforced with fiber glass.
2. The HV windings are cast under vacuum and high pressure conditions in Germany HUBERS vacuum Cast Machine, resulting the best resin penetration and very low partial discharge( partial discharge for 11kV product could be lower than 5Pc).
3. Optimized structure is adopted for HV windings to improve transformer's electric field. Lighting impulse simulation calculation was adopted for winding model design, thus to substantially improve product's anti-lighting capability.
